Output e158eb3aec609f58c4c91692659b9a6e00050af9a2f0a5fa0f075aa51328464d:1

value
4245864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2421776ed802242fa53b5ac4cc2a6f07bc83a650 OP_EQUALVERIFY OP_CHECKSIG
address
14J3RCgufsqAhZH7FkbPqorMyzGuDN4z9w
transaction
e158eb3aec609f58c4c91692659b9a6e00050af9a2f0a5fa0f075aa51328464d
spent
true